Understanding the Basics of Water Lifting Pumps
The functionality and applications of various types cater to diverse water pumping requirements. Water lifting pumps are devices that are specifically designed to lift water from a lower level to a higher level. They work by creating suction or pressure to draw water into the pump and then push it upwards. There are different types of water lifting pumps available, including centrifugal pumps, submersible pumps, and jet pumps, each with their own unique features and advantages.
Types of Water Lifting Pumps
Centrifugal pumps utilize impeller rotation for efficient water pumping. Submersible pumps are submerged in water to pump effectively. Diaphragm pumps use a flexible diaphragm for water pumping. Gear pumps are ideal for high-viscosity fluids. Air lift pumps utilize compressed air to lift water.

When choosing a water lifting pump for your home, it is essential to consider your specific needs. Factors such as the volume of water you need to move, the distance between your water source and desired output location, and any potential obstacles or restrictions should be considered. To determine the appropriate size for your needs, calculate how much total head (vertical height) you need to lift the water and then decide on a pump with enough horsepower (HP) to accommodate that demand.

Indicators of a Bad Water Pump
Reduced water flow or pressure suggests potential issues with the water pump's performance. Unusual noises and vibrations may signify problems, while a decrease in efficiency can be an indicator of underlying issues. Leaks, drips, and malfunctions should not be overlooked. Monitoring for erratic behavior helps identify signs of poor performance.

How Many Gallons Per Minute Can be a Pump to Move?
The pump's capacity is measured in gallons per minute (GPM). This rating indicates the volume of water the pump can move within a minute. It helps determine the efficiency and effectiveness of the pump in distributing water. Understanding the GPM capability is crucial for matching it to your specific water demands.
